IT is all change in the Best Finance & Service Package award, as Volkswagen gives way to Citroen, or as it’s now called, Free2Move Lease.

So why the change? Well, Free2Move Lease has watched what rivals are offering and created a solution with Fleet Command and Fleet Command Plus, that has taken over from competition such as last year’s winner – Volkswagen.

Free2Move Lease can now offer a Contract Hire and Finance Lease with and without balloon payment through Citroen Contract Motoring.

However, for smaller van fleets and sole traders, they also offer Lease purchase and a flexible PCP product – with no restrictions for business type for any of their products.

One of the key developments over the last year has been the launch of Fleet Command – a free of charge service.

This service is designed to assist their LCV customers to remain compliant in terms of their Duty of Care obligations, ensuring that LCV customers have access to professional CV experience in managing their vehicle(s) during the contract, and that the customer is given the best information to reduce any potential end of term charges. Needless to say this service also greatly reduces business administration for the SME users.

Fleet Command utilises a GPS mileage feed from the telematics box fitted as standard to Citroen Berlingo, Dispatch and Relay models, which integrates with Free2Move Lease’s bespoke Fleet Management Systems.

Fleet Command then contacts customers with Service Due Reminders (regardless of lease type/customer size) based around the GPS mileage of the vehicle (or time, whichever comes first) in line with the manufacturer recommendations. This also applies to MOTs.

The customer has a one number solution for all activities and the Fleet Command team can centrally make the appropriate service bookings, ensuring the least disruption to the customer throughout the contract term. Each activity is logged to assist customers with their service history and personal preferences are noted for preferred dealer/most suitable times/requirement for courtesy vehicle etc.

Customers can also use the dedicated Fleet Command section of the Citroen Contract Motoring website or email routes for requests or enquiries. In addition, the driver can report any vehicle defects to Fleet Command, who will make the necessary arrangements for suitable repairs.

All services, defect repairs and mechanical roadside incidents are then monitored on the day to ensure complete and professional repairs.
The Fleet Command team monitor any manufacturer recalls and proactively manage these with customers and dealers with convenience and minimum downtime in mind. Every customer is supplied with Roadside Assistance throughout their duration of their contract.

In addition, the Fleet Command team compares GPS mileage with the contractual mileage, and posts advisory letters to customers heavily exceeding their contractual mileage. This allows the customer to amend their contractual mileage during the remainder of their contract or make adjustments to their commercial vehicle fleet usage to avoid excess mileage charges.

Excess mileage is one of the key challenges for fleet and leasing companies. This Free of Charge service takes CCM to the next level in their offering with many competitors charging large monthly payments for an often lesser service. CCM also offers as an option, Fleet Command Plus for fleets.
